  1. Match the Hardware Version: Never install software meant for a different model number. Even within the same model (e.g., Supermax 9950), there can be different hardware versions (V1.0, V2.0, V3.0). Installing the wrong version will permanently damage your device.
  2. Stable Power Supply: Ensure your electricity does not cut out during the update process. A power failure mid-update will corrupt the receiver.
  3. No Guarantee: "Free software" found online is often unofficial. Proceed at your own risk.

  1. Look at the front panel of your receiver for the model number (e.g., Supermax 9950, 9000, 9990, Nano).
  2. Look at the sticker on the bottom of the receiver. Note the Main Version or Hardware Version.
  3. Go to Menu > System Settings > System Information on your TV. Write down the current software version.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

| Issue | Solution | | :--- | :--- | | USB Not Detected | Try a different USB drive. Ensure it is formatted to FAT32. Try a different USB port if available. | | Update Failed / Short Circuit | The software version is likely incorrect for your specific hardware version. Find the correct version matching your board. | | No Signal After Update | Perform a Factory Reset and re-scan your satellite frequencies. Check your LNB settings. | | Channels Missing | You may need to upload a new channel list file (.udf) or manually scan transponders. |
